2. Fishing Bridge RV Park
As the only RV park located within Yellowstone National Park, Fishing Bridge RV Park is a prime option for those wanting to be in the heart of the action. The park features full-hookup sites and is close to popular sites like Yellowstone Lake and the Grand Canyon of the Yellowstone River. Note that reservations are required, and amenities include a dump station, potable water, and access to visitor facilities.
